Prioritize Daily Exercise and Playtime
Regular physical activity helps them maintain a healthy weight, prevents boredom, and strengthens the bond between you and your pup.
“Do you know that the French Bulldogs are prone to overheating due to their brachycephalic (short-nosed) features? They should always avoid strenuous activity in hot weather. (Information from UrgentVet)
Additionally, “keep your brachycephalic Frenchie cool and comfy: feed well, exercise wisely, walk during cooler hours, choose shaded routes, protect paws, and keep hydration handy with short, fun strolls instead of long ones.” (According to the PedMD)

Establish a Consistent Feeding Routine
Pied French Bulldogs (like all Frenchies) can be prone to obesity, which can lead to joint problems and other health issues. Feeding them high-quality, breed-appropriate dog food ensures they receive the right balance of nutrients. Most can be free fed without problems, but if weight does become an issue, measure portions should be given a couple of times per day.
“Pet owners can give their pups a strong start with a healthy diet, guided by AAFCO’s standards for nutrition and labeling, ensuring long, happy, and vibrant lives.” (According to the Dogster News)
Stick to a consistent feeding schedule, typically twice a day, and avoid overfeeding or giving too many treats. Fresh water should always be available, as hydration supports healthy skin, digestion, and energy levels.

Stimulate Their Mind with Training and Games
A happy Pied French Bulldog is not just physically active but mentally engaged. Cognitive stimulation through training, problem-solving games, or new experiences can prevent behavioral issues like excessive barking or chewing.
“Teach simple commands like ‘sit,’ ‘stay,’ or ‘come,’ and gradually introduce more complex tricks as your dog learns. Use positive reinforcement treats, praise, and affection, and maintain consistency across your household for best results.” (According to the BlueHaven Blog)
Puzzle feeders, interactive toys, and short scent games challenge their minds while keeping them entertained.
Maintain Grooming and Health Checkups
Pied French Bulldogs (as do all Frenchies) have short coats, but they still require regular grooming to stay healthy. Brush their coat weekly to remove loose hair and check for skin irritations, as French Bulldogs can be prone to allergies and sensitive skin.

Create a Comfortable Living Environment
A comfortable bed, access to shade in hot weather, and a quiet corner for downtime contribute to their emotional well-being.
Avoid leaving your Pied French Bulldog alone for long periods, as they can develop separation anxiety. Enrichment items like chew toys or a soft blanket with your scent can comfort them when you’re away.

How Often Should You Exercise a Pied French Bulldog?
Your Pied French Bulldog thrives on daily activity! Gentle walks twice a day, short indoor play sessions, and interactive games keep them healthy, happy, and energized. Avoid overheating in hot weather—morning or evening sessions work best.
What’s The Best Diet For A Pied French Bulldog?
Feed your Pied French Bulldog high-quality, breed-specific food twice daily. Measure portions may be necessary to prevent obesity, and always provide fresh water. High-quality dog treats are fine in moderation. A balanced diet keeps their coat shiny, energy levels high, and overall health in check.
How Can You Keep Your Pied French Bulldog Mentally Stimulated?
Keep your Frenchie’s mind sharp with puzzle toys, scent games, and short training sessions. Mental challenges reduce boredom, prevent behavioral issues, and strengthen your bond, making daily life more fun for both of you.
